I believe it slows one down.
Xbench gave me:
34.45 for Tiger (10.4.11) run system.
29.93 for same hardware setup under Leopard (10.5.7).
I'm satisfied with the speed of Leopard for the projects I do on the DA.
I will probably go back to Tiger for my QS 2002 Dual 1GHz, primarily
for my M-Audio 2496 PCI card isn't still up to date with Leopard. M-
Audio stopped at Tiger. I use Leopard on it now because I am using
Final Cut Express, which I think requires Leopard ... or my version of
iDVD I need requires Leopard, for my VHS to DVD conversions.
The need for Speed is somewhat relative, and a personal choice, for my
G4s.
